Weekend Teaching Series: Write them On My Heart (A series on the 10 Commandments)
Message Title: Word Seven: You Will Not Commit Adultery
Sermon in a Sentence: God’s plan for marriage: One man, one woman, becoming one flesh, for one lifetime.
Text(s): Genesis 1:27, 2:23-24; Matthew 19:1-12; 1 Corinthians 7:4; Ephesians 5:25-33
Weekend Scale of Difficulty: 5 of 10 extremely straightforward service, the difficulty was communicating about adultery in a way teens found relevant. Way too easy to simply skip past that one and say “It doesn’t apply to me because I’m not married yet.”
Message Summary: We started by challenging that viewpoint that this command doesn’t apply to us because we aren’t married yet (or at least my teens aren’t – I am.) We looked at the fact that the command about murder, far from simply prohibiting premeditated fatal violence actually calls the people of God to a profound respect for life. In the same way this command calls those who would call themselves God’s children to have and to demonstrate a profound respect for marriage.
